Josh is a recent and vibrant addition to the NSM team, bringing a passion for movement, performance, and community. With a background in theatrical movement and fight choreography, he blends creativity and physicality to help people move better, feel stronger, and thrive—on stage and in life.
Originally from Melbourne’s theatre scene, Josh has worked as a fight choreographer and movement coach across stages and studios. He believes everyone is an athlete in their own way and loves translating lessons from performance training to the gym floor, helping members find confidence, strength, and joy in how they move.
Josh’s own fitness story began with a congenital heart defect that made running a challenge—apparently as a kid he looked like he was running in slow motion. As funny as that was to watch, he had life changing surgery at the age of 8 and got all patched up. These days, you’ll catch him hitting the trails early on Sunday mornings. On Sunday afternoons you’ll find him refreshing Strava and begging for kudos.
In the studio, Josh is known for his high energy, pumping playlists, and an ability to coach both technique and mindset. Whether you’re brand new to training or looking to level up, he’s all about helping you bring your best self to the gym floor.
